Book Description

How did a remote desert people change the course of world history?

In the seventh century AD, the Eastern Roman Empire collapsed—defeated by the rising power of Arabia. How did this happen? And why then?
In this gripping new history, Nick Holmes offers a fresh view of the end of the Ancient World and the rise of Islam—it wasn’t just religion and war that shaped history, but a hidden force also played a vital role—climate change. A mysterious climatic shift—the Late Antique Little Ice Age—devastated the Roman and Persian empires while Arabia thrived.
The End of Antiquity brings together history, science, and religion to uncover the truth behind one of the most enigmatic centuries in history. It’s the fifth book in Holmes’ acclaimed series on the fall of the Roman Empire—and the most surprising yet.

Editorial Reviews

Review

Overall, this volume makes a significant contribution to the discussion of the fall of Rome—a dominant topic on library shelves for more than a millennium. It does so by blending a traditional top-down history with an environmental survey based on contemporary scientific data. Particularly convincing is the book’s argument that the Late Antique Little Ice Age caused a demographic and economic collapse in Rome and Persia, but had little effect on Arabia, which was largely unaffected by the impact of climate change. Kirkus Reviews
